ABOUT WFP

The United Nations World Food Programme is the world's largest humanitarian agency fighting hunger worldwide. The mission of WFP is to help the world achieve Zero Hunger in our lifetimes. Every day, WFP works worldwide to ensure that no child goes to bed hungry and that the poorest and most vulnerable, particularly women and children, can access the nutritious food they need.

ABOUT THIS OPPORTUNITY

WFP Tajikistan is building a Roster of Administration Associates to coordinate and provide high quality, client-focused and value-for-money oriented administration services in any of WFP duty stations in Tajikistan (Dushanbe, Khujand, Bokhtar, Gharm and Khorog).

KEY ACCOUNTABILITIES (not all-inclusive)

  1. Verify resource requirements in the area of responsibility (WFP facilities, assets, light vehicle fleet, etc.), and assist in the identification of new requirements to facilitate efficiency and cost-effectiveness of operations and services.
  2. Responsible for provision of services such as facilities management, travel, protocol and light vehicle management related, etc., reporting any discrepancies to the supervisor for consistent and timely delivery of services, to ensure the provision of a safe and comfortable working environment for WFP staff.
  3. Support the production of various data and compile and prepare reports in order to contribute to the provision of accurate information for informative decision-making and to support the effective and timely management of WFP resources.
  4. Contribute to planning, monitoring and processing administrative actions related to procurement, finance, human resources, etc., including contracts with external vendors to ensure all data is accurately and timely recorded, processed in WFP corporate systems and any operational issues addressed.
  5. Adapt and update administrative processes, supporting the implementation of operating procedures, in order to contribute to the continuous improvement of administration services in the area of responsibility.
  6. Answer a range of queries related to the provision of administrative services in order to support the resolution of daily issues.
  7. Coordinate the activities of a team of staff working in the area, to ensure individual and team objectives are met in compliance with all relevant regulations, policies, and procedures, knowledge sharing and performance/ PACE plan executed in a timely manner.
  8. Provide ongoing training/guidance and capacity building to admin staff in interpretation of administrative procedures, policies, processes, and use of corporate systems to ensure consistency and uninterrupted services provided to all clients.
  9. Prepare and submit for review and approval monthly Admin/Asset and Fleet management reports to Supervisor and relevant RBB/ FleetCenter/ GEMS etc.
  10. Perform other related tasks and assignments as required.

STANDARD M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Education: Completion of secondary school education. A post-secondary certificate in the related functional area.

Language: Fluency in English language, fluency in Tajik and/or Russian.

Experience: A minimum of 6 years work experience in administration.

DESIRED EXPERIENCES FOR ENTRY INTO THE ROLE

  • Three years of experience in general administration with UN, NGOs or other International Organizations
  • Experience in fleet management, inventory management, travel management and protocol.
